We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ced MES Implementation & Support Specialist to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for the successful implementation configuration maintenance and support of MES Implementation delivered by Bosch.
Implementation & Configuration:
Participate in the MES implementation lifecycle from requirements gathering to go-live.
Configure and customize MES modules to meet specific business requirements.
Develop and execute test plans to ensure system functionality and data integrity.
Document system configurations and implementation processes.
Collaborate with vendors and SMS / consultants during the implementation process.
Support & Maintenance:
Provide day-to-day support to MES users troubleshooting issues and resolving problems in a timely manner.
Monitor system performance and identify areas for improvement.
Perform system maintenance tasks including upgrades patches and backups.
Develop and maintain user documentation and training materials.
Manage user access and security permissions.
Process Improvement & Optimization:
Analyze manufacturing processes and identify opportunities to optimize efficiency and reduce costs.
Work with manufacturing teams to define and implement best practices for MES usage.
Develop and implement new MES functionalities to support evolving business needs.
Participate in continuous improvement initiatives related to manufacturing operations.
Training & Documentation:
Develop and deliver training programs for MES users at various levels.
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for system configuration processes and troubleshooting.
Keep abreast of new features and functionalities and share knowledge with the team.
Collaboration & Communication:
Work closely with manufacturing IT engineering and quality teams to ensure seamless integration of MES with other systems.
Communicate effectively with st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
Participate in project meetings and provide regular updates on progress
Qualifications :
Educational qualification:
Bachelors degree in Computer Science Engineering Manufacturing Technology or a related field.
Experience :
2-5 years of experience in implementing and supporting Cantier MES in a manufacturing environment.
Mandatory/requires Skill
Strong understanding of manufacturing process including production planning shop floor control quality control and inventory management.
Proficiency in configuring and customizing MES modules.
Experience with database management systems (e.g. SQL Server Oracle).
Experience with report writing tools (e.g. Crystal Reports SSRS).
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.
Strong communication interpersonal and teamwork skills.
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
Experience with mention any specific industries relevant to your company e.g. automotive electronics food & beverage
Preferred Skills :
Experience with other MES systems.
Knowledge of lean manufacturing principles.
Experience with PLC programming.
Experience with ERP integration (e.g. SAP Oracle).
Project management experience.
Additional Information :
This role requires a strong understanding of manufacturing processes excellent technical skills and the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ams. The candidate will play a key role in optimizing our manufacturing processes.
Candidate would also be required to travel both for pre-sales and project related activities to customer locations
